Transaction 30c62c45681b288b7649f92dfc4648c33b99ce1f4f0a23b822a91161be9d6740

5 Input
2 Outputs
  • 30c62c45681b288b7649f92dfc4648c33b99ce1f4f0a23b822a91161be9d6740:0
  • value  1321370000
    address  19v8BNi72jLuSYSzitoMJUK3a3hWNQb47y
  • 30c62c45681b288b7649f92dfc4648c33b99ce1f4f0a23b822a91161be9d6740:1
  • value  1431330171
    address  1G1pAcXRuRBWpyZpaEDhPZ31qattRJJqnJ